The length of a rectangle is represented by the function L(x) = 5x. The width of that same rectangle is represented by the funct
ion W(x) = 2x^2 − 4x + 13. Which of the following shows the area of the rectangle in terms of x?
2 answers:
Recall that Rectangle area is the multiple of W*L
So Multiply both equations, you will get the area in terms of x.
The answer would be => A(x)=10x^3-20x^2+65x
